diff options
author | Anthony Iliopoulos <ailiop@suse.com> | 2022-02-03 12:42:30 -0500 |
---|---|---|
committer | Eric Sandeen <sandeen@sandeen.net> | 2022-02-03 12:42:30 -0500 |
commit | f8c9cdc4017d4281eaab8930b9144e88d1bf8cc7 (patch) | |
tree | f275fb121a7055da8fc95889f19a8f2bfb6420e4 | |
parent | 15689d8ce87875fbee2b46c899f8fb9f21b0b669 (diff) | |
download | xfsdump-dev-f8c9cdc4017d4281eaab8930b9144e88d1bf8cc7.tar.gz |
xfsdump: remove obsolete code for handling xenix named pipes
We can safely drop support for XENIX named pipes (S_IFNAM) at this
point, since this was never implemented in Linux.
Signed-off-by: Anthony Iliopoulos <ailiop@suse.com>
Reviewed-by: Darrick J. Wong <darrick.wong@oracle.com>
Signed-off-by: Eric Sandeen <sandeen@sandeen.net>
-rw-r--r-- | doc/files.obj | 2 | ||||
-rw-r--r-- | doc/xfsdump.html | 1 | ||||
-rw-r--r-- | dump/content.c | 3 | ||||
-rw-r--r-- | dump/inomap.c | 3 | ||||
-rw-r--r-- | restore/content.c | 8 |
5 files changed, 1 insertions, 16 deletions
diff --git a/doc/files.obj b/doc/files.obj index 4f4653ac..098620e3 100644 --- a/doc/files.obj +++ b/doc/files.obj @@ -295,7 +295,7 @@ minilines(486,15,0,0,0,0,0,[ mini_line(486,12,3,0,0,0,[ str_block(0,486,12,3,0,-4,0,0,0,[ str_seg('black','Courier',0,80640,486,12,3,0,-4,0,0,0,0,0, - "Other File (S_IFCHAR|S_IFBLK|S_IFIFO|S_IFNAM|S_IFSOCK)")]) + "Other File (S_IFCHAR|S_IFBLK|S_IFIFO|S_IFSOCK)")]) ]) ])]). text('black',48,244,2,0,1,54,30,379,12,3,0,0,0,0,2,54,30,0,0,"",0,0,0,0,256,'',[ diff --git a/doc/xfsdump.html b/doc/xfsdump.html index 9d06129a..958bc805 100644 --- a/doc/xfsdump.html +++ b/doc/xfsdump.html @@ -100,7 +100,6 @@ or stdout. The dump includes all the filesystem objects of: <li>character special files (S_IFCHR) <li>block special files (S_IFBLK) <li>named pipes (S_FIFO) -<li>XENIX named pipes (S_IFNAM) </ul> It does not dump files from <i>/var/xfsdump</i> which is where the xfsdump inventory is located. diff --git a/dump/content.c b/dump/content.c index 7637fe89..75b79220 100644 --- a/dump/content.c +++ b/dump/content.c @@ -3883,9 +3883,6 @@ dump_file(void *arg1, case S_IFCHR: case S_IFBLK: case S_IFIFO: -#ifdef S_IFNAM - case S_IFNAM: -#endif case S_IFLNK: case S_IFSOCK: /* only need a filehdr_t; no data diff --git a/dump/inomap.c b/dump/inomap.c index 85f76df6..85d61c35 100644 --- a/dump/inomap.c +++ b/dump/inomap.c @@ -1723,9 +1723,6 @@ estimate_dump_space(struct xfs_bstat *statp) case S_IFIFO: case S_IFCHR: case S_IFDIR: -#ifdef S_IFNAM - case S_IFNAM: -#endif case S_IFBLK: case S_IFSOCK: case S_IFLNK: diff --git a/restore/content.c b/restore/content.c index 6b22965b..97f82132 100644 --- a/restore/content.c +++ b/restore/content.c @@ -7313,9 +7313,6 @@ restore_file_cb(void *cp, bool_t linkpr, char *path1, char *path2) case S_IFBLK: case S_IFCHR: case S_IFIFO: -#ifdef S_IFNAM - case S_IFNAM: -#endif case S_IFSOCK: ok = restore_spec(fhdrp, rvp, path1); return ok; @@ -7797,11 +7794,6 @@ restore_spec(filehdr_t *fhdrp, rv_t *rvp, char *path) case S_IFIFO: printstr = _("named pipe"); break; -#ifdef S_IFNAM - case S_IFNAM: - printstr = _("XENIX named pipe"); - break; -#endif case S_IFSOCK: printstr = _("UNIX domain socket"); break; |